William Wilson, TOTP was like that. The program did not want full playback and at the same time they did not have the time to set up the studio for a full live recording, so they just added the live vocals, which was easy to do.

@swimologist8: Bill Wyman was the bass player, so it would be kind of odd for him to be hitting Carlie Watts' cymbals. It was pretty rare at that time for bands to be allowed to play live when appearing on TV shows. Usually it would only be the vocals that were live (sometimes not even those). There were exceptions, but it was just faster & cheaper for the shows to do things that way - the bands didn't have much say in the matter. Btw, "lip syncing" would mean that he *wasn't* singing live.
